A joint UK-Korea aerospace materials research centre at Rolls-Royce plc, in Derby, has been extended until 2006. The original agreement paving the way for the centre was signed in October 1994, as part of Korea's programme of becoming one of the world's top ten aerospace nations. Since the centre opened in 1996, it has been working on materials behaviour for a number of alloys used to make aero engine blades, vanes and discs. The centre, which uses facilities at Cambridge and Birmingham Universities, is also working on predicting the life of aero engine discs. The second phase of its work will cover more research and development programmes, including materials, manufacturing and design-related research. Both Rolls-Royce and KIMM (the Korea Institute of Machinery and Metals) will continue to work together to enable Korean industrial partners to participate in the second phase.
